Neither beggars, nor thieves. Roma people want to be physicians
Climbing up a tram and harass the audience by playing an accordion. And end the performance without begging, but giving medical advice to the audience. This is the provocation by a group of young Roma students in Bucharest, determined to overturn the popular stereotypes about their community in collaboration with the Open Society Foundations. “I was not born with rhythm in my veins,” said Madalina, who wants to be a doctor one day. “We are not here to beg,” her fellows add “studying is important to us. And it is important that you know that the Roma do not always want to ask you or steal something. They can also offer you something”.Just like them, young doctors, ready to offer free examinations and a hot tea in the crowded streets.
